Summary:
The city of Abrams, Wisconsin is home to a single elementary school, Abrams Elementary, which serves students in grades PK-5. This school has consistently ranked among the top 15% of elementary schools in Wisconsin over the past 3 years, according to the SchoolDigger rankings, placing it among the state's top-performing institutions.
Abrams Elementary boasts impressive test scores, with the majority of grades scoring above the district and state averages in core subjects like English Language Arts, Mathematics, Social Studies, and Science. The school also maintains a relatively low chronic absenteeism rate of 17.7%, which is better than the state average. With a student-teacher ratio of 13.5 to 1 and per-student spending of $13,514, Abrams Elementary appears to be well-resourced and dedicated to supporting student success.
While Abrams Elementary is a standout school within the Oconto Falls Public School District, there may be opportunities for further improvement, particularly in areas where its test scores are closer to the district or state averages, such as 4th grade Science and 5th grade Mathematics. Overall, Abrams Elementary is a high-performing school that provides a quality education to its students, and its consistent excellence makes it a desirable option for families in the Abrams area.
